Legal and Regulatory Considerations

The biggest hurdle for UK players using foreign casinos is the regulatory framework. U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) licenses offer player protections that non UK casinos might not provide. These sites are usually regulated by authorities such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the Curacao eGaming Commission, which differ significantly in enforcement and standards.

Are these regulatory bodies trustworthy? It depends. The Malta Gaming Authority is generally regarded as strict and reputable, while Curacao licenses are sometimes viewed as more lenient. This inevitably affects player safety, dispute resolution, and the fairness of games, which often have RTP rates around 96% or higher on reputable platforms.

Players should keep in mind that, unlike UKGC-licensed casinos, winnings from non UK operators might not enjoy the same legal protections or guarantees. It’s a balance between access and risk that everyone needs to weigh carefully.

Practical Tips for Choosing the Right Platform

Finding a trustworthy non UK casino isn’t as simple as typing a name into a search engine. From my experience, the best approach involves a mix of research, careful checking, and a bit of skepticism. Here are some practical pointers to keep in mind:

  1. Verify the casino’s license and regulator to ensure it holds a valid and recognized permit.
  2. Look for transparency in terms and conditions, especially concerning withdrawals and bonuses.
  3. Check whether the platform uses SSL encryption to protect your personal and financial data.
  4. Consider the availability of trusted payment methods like Visa, Mastercard, or e-wallets, which often indicate operational reliability.
  5. Read player reviews and forums to catch red flags or consistent complaints.

Even seasoned gamblers sometimes overlook these checks, which leads to issues like frozen accounts or delayed payments. The gambling world is exciting but fraught with pitfalls, so a cautious approach is best.

Responsible Gambling: A Vital Reminder

Regardless of the jurisdiction, gambling should always be approached with care. The lack of direct UKGC oversight means that players need to be extra vigilant about managing their habits. Setting deposit limits, keeping track of time spent, and recognizing when to take a break are essential practices.

Many non UK casinos offer responsible gambling tools, but the effectiveness varies. It’s up to each individual to use these resources wisely. After all, the thrill of the game is diminished if it leads to financial or emotional distress.
